1, Uk Cottages Dawley Road, Hayes, UB3 1EQ is a freehold terraced property built between 1900-1929. The property offers approximately 721 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£425,738 , which equates to approximately £590 per square foot. It was last sold on 19 Jul 2006 for £200,000. Since then, the value has increased by £225,738, representing a 112.9% increase, or approximately 5.8% per year.

1, Uk Cottages Dawley Road, Hayes, Hillingdon, Greater London Authority, UB3 1EQ has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of E, based on the latest assessment carried out on 17 Jul 2013.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 17 Dec 2008. The rating of E remains the same, but the energy efficiency score improved by 5%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The main heating energy efficiency improving from average to good, while the heating system type remained the same (boiler and radiators, mains gas).
  • The windows were upgraded from partial double glazing to fully double glazed.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 50%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 42% of fixed outlets, with efficiency changing from good to average.
